Canberra Airport non-jet Departure Safety Change

In mid-2026, the opening of Western Sydney International (WSI) Airport will require changes to Canberra Airport’s non-jet departure routes. These routes will shift to the west to safely integrate with the new airspace operations. There are no changes to the departures until west of Lake George. As the area under the new departure path is already frequently overflown and as aircraft will be at a relatively high altitude, the shift of this departure path is unlikely to be noticeable to communities.
